Go to Settings > Integrations and connect your Google Business Profile and Facebook Business Page. Once connected, the platform automatically pulls in your existing reviews from both platforms.
Connecting Google and Facebook profiles in Integrations settings

Configure your review settings
Go to Reputation in the left sidebar, then open Settings. Configure:
Review request link: Customize the direct link sent to contacts when requesting a review
Automated review request messages: Set up the email and SMS templates used for review requests
Review widget: Configure the website widget that displays your reviews as social proof

Send review requests
Request reviews from individual contacts or in bulk:
Individual: From any contact profile or active conversation, click Request Review
Bulk: From the Contacts section, select a list or smart list and use the Bulk Action to send review requests to all selected contacts at once
Sending review requests from the Reputation section of the HoopAI Platform
Timing matters. Send the review request within 24 hours of a completed service or positive interaction while the experience is still fresh in the customer’s mind. Automated workflow-triggered requests are the most effective approach.

View and manage reviews
In the Reputation tab, view all your Google and Facebook reviews in one place. See the review text, star rating, date, platform, and response status at a glance.

Respond to reviews
Click any review to open a response editor. Write your reply and submit — your response is published directly to Google or Facebook without leaving the HoopAI Platform.
Responding to a Google or Facebook review from within the HoopAI Platform
Responding to both positive and negative reviews shows responsiveness, builds trust with potential customers, and encourages more customers to leave reviews of their own.

Dispute negative or spam reviews
For reviews that are inaccurate, inappropriate, or spam, use the Dispute option within the review details. This flags the review for removal consideration by Google or Facebook.
Responding to reviews — both positive and negative — signals to potential customers that you are engaged and care about their experience. It also signals to Google’s algorithm that your listing is active, which can improve your local search ranking over time.
Setting up automated review requests
You can trigger automatic review requests through workflows. After a client completes an appointment, or a job is marked as done, a workflow can automatically send them a review request — capturing feedback while the experience is fresh.
The review widget
The review widget can be embedded on your website to display your Google and Facebook reviews automatically. This builds social proof for new visitors without any ongoing manual work required.
Bulk review requests
If you have an existing customer list, consider sending a one-time bulk review request campaign. Even a modest response rate from a large list can significantly increase your review count and average rating.
